The Rolex SailGP Championship is the most exciting racing on water, where anything can happen in short, adrenaline-fueled battles between national teams at iconic stadium destinations worldwide. Top athletes fly in identical high-tech F50 catamarans faster than the wind, at speeds approaching 60 mph. Founded in 2018, SailGP is one of the world's fastest-growing sports and entertainment properties, now in its fifth season.
SailGP also races for a better future, championing a world powered by nature. In 2020, SailGP set a new standard as the first climate positive sports and entertainment property and began delivering actions and innovations that advance the global adoption of clean energy. Summary:
Oversee the planning, procurement, delivery and management of temporary event infrastructure including large scale temporary structures and grandstands across global SailGP events. Ensure high standards, regulatory compliance, effective vendor coordination and alignment with operational goals. Responsible for scheduling, budgeting and maintaining clear communication with stakeholders throughout the season. The ideal candidate must have a construction background.
Key Responsibilities
- Create, implement and manage a global temporary overlay infrastructure system for all SailGP events annually
- Establish highest quality standards for vendors and ensure a consistent, global delivery
- Negotiate and manage procurement processes for temporary event infrastructure
- Collate comprehensive technical drawings, specifications and documentations for all temporary structures ensuring detailed spatial layouts
- Ensure all structure designs meet safety regulations, building codes, and accessibility requirements
- Manage integrated build schedules and critical path planning for all venue preparations
- Communicate effectively with all stakeholders regarding build schedules and readiness
- Maintain close working relationship with staging and operations team and wider business functions to ensure all operational concerns are addressed
- Develop and manage budgets for all temporary infrastructure across the season
- Oversee the construction and installation of all temporary event infrastructure ensure compliance with site safety standards
- Oversee structural engineering assessments where required
- Forecast future infrastructure requirements and associated costs
- Maintain appropriate documentation for insurance and compliance purposes
